Division over Ukraine in Italy’s largest party

Italy’s largest political party, the 5 Star Movement, has split over arms supplies to Ukraine

Italian Foreign Minister Luigi Di Mayo has left the party faction.
According to Italian media, the majority of the party led by former Prime Minister Giuseppe Conte believes that the supply of weapons to Ukraine will prolong the conflict.
Di Mayo, one of the most ardent supporters of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ky among European politicians, disagrees.
The Foreign Minister said that the decision to leave the party faction was not easy.
On which side of history
According to him, his party members “should have long ago decided which side of history – the side of the attacked Ukraine or the aggressor Russia.”
The Il Post writes that 62 deputies, including 11 senators, may leave the faction together with Di Mayo.
Earlier, N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g said in an interview with the German publication Bild am Sonntag that the war in Ukraine could last for years.
He called on his allies to continue supporting Kiev in this war.
According to Stoltenberg, the allies will decide at the NATO summit in Madrid to call Russia a “security threat” rather than a “partner.”
The summit is also expected to decide on the supply of more weapons to Ukraine.
